在Spring Boot应用中配置MyBatis,包括Mapper接口的扫描路径等: 通常情况下,mybatis-spring-boot-starter会自动配置MyBatis,但你可以通过@MapperScan注解来指定Mapper接口的扫描路径,以确保MyBatis能够扫描到这些接口。 java import org.mybatis.spring.annotation.MapperScan; import org.springframework.boot.SpringApplica...
useUnicode=true&characterEncoding=utf-8&useSSL=true&serverTimezone=UTC7spring.datasource.driver-class-name=com.mysql.jdbc.Driver8# mybatis9mybatis.mapper-locations=classpath:mapping/*Mapper.xml 10 mybatis.type-aliases-package=com.bie.demo.po 11 # 后台打印sql语句 12 mybatis.configuration.log-imp...
Springboot2.x集成mybatis连接多个mysql数据源(其他不同数据库都可以),程序员大本营,技术文章内容聚合第一站。
spring.datasource.password=root #mybatis数据库映射文件配置 mybatis.config-locations=classpath:mybatis/mybatis-config.xml mybatis.mapper-locations=classpath:mybatis/mapper/*.xml mybatis-config.xml———数据类型的别名 <configuration> <typeAliases> <typeAlias alias="Integer" type="java.lang.Integer"...
发现同事有些在操作mybatis上的盲点,或许你也曾经中招过。现在使用的是springboot项目整合的mybatis,就根据这个说吧。有些都是通用的。 这里主要集中在dao层和mapper文件上,配置上。 1.配置部分 1.1首先是springboot引入... 使用Mybatis Generator工具逆向操作Mysql数据库...
SpringBoot集成MyBatis实现MySQL操作 一、前言 在我们日常的Web应用开发中,数据库的操作不可避免。而SpringBoot做为一款快速开发的框架,有着优秀的集成能力,可以快速集成其他框架。MyBatis是一个优秀的ORM框架,可以大大的简化我们的数据库操作。我们使用SpringBoot集成Mybatis可以让我们实现高效的MySQL增删改查的操作,大大...
mybatis属于半自动的ORM,相比hibernate这种全自动的ORM,兼顾了性能与易用;目前企业项目中,基本都是mybatis的天下;今天就来整合mybatis与MySQL; 回到顶部 1、整合 1.-1、添加依赖: <!-- 集成mybatis --> <dependency> <groupId>org.mybatis.spring.boot</groupId> ...
这个方法就是用于注册bean信息的,这里注册的是mapper的信息,主要逻辑就是通过org.mybatis.spring.mapper.ClassPathMapperScanner#doScan这个方法扫描项目包下的使用@Mapper的类或接口,然后进行bean信息的注册,核心逻辑在org.mybatis.spring.mapper.ClassPathMapperScanner#processBeanDefinitions在这个方法里,这里说下@Mapper...
在下文是通过注解方式:Java开发进阶之路:Spring Boot 集成MySQL - MyBatis Plus注解方式快速上手指南,全程实操演示 一、Mysql环境搭建 1. 安装 为了自测方便,直接使用docker部署mysql,命令如下: docker run -d --name mysql8 -e MYSQL_ROOT_PASSWORD=mysql_root -p 51234:3306 mysql:8.0.22 ...
Spring Boot集成MyBatis访问MySQL 一、引言 在当今企业级应用开发中,Spring Boot、MyBatis与MySQL的组合凭借其高效性和灵活性,成为构建数据驱动型应用的首选方案。本文将带你从零开始搭建项目,掌握Spring Boot集成MyBatis的基础入门内容。 二、项目搭建 1.1 初始化Spring Boot项目 ...